What should I see when I'm in Scranton?
If you're looking for some ways to explore Scranton while making the most of your travel budget, this destination has lots to offer. Spots where you'll find natural beauty on display include Nay Aug Park, Lackawanna River and Lackawanna River Heritage Trail. Other places not to be missed include The Marketplace at Steamtown, Steamtown National Historic Site and Lackawanna Coal Mine Tour.
